Fixing the dynamical evolution of self-interacting vector fields

Fixing the dynamical evolution of self-interacting vector fields

Numerical simulations of the Cauchy problem for self-interacting massive vector fields often face instabilities and apparent pathologies. We explicitly demonstrate that these issues, previously reported in the literature, are actually due to the breakdown of the well-posedness of the initial-value problem.
